Understanding Para-Aramid Fibers
Before diving into the innovations, it’s essential to understand what para-aramid fibers are and why they are vital in body armor. Para-aramid is a type of synthetic fiber characterized by its exceptional tensile strength, which means it can withstand significant stress and impact without breaking. Commonly recognized brands like Kevlar and Twaron exemplify the applications of para-aramid fibers in developing protective clothing, ensuring soldiers, law enforcement officers, and civilians can safely navigate high-risk environments.
These fibers are not just strong; they’re lightweight and flexible, allowing for body armor that doesn’t compromise mobility for protection. As 2025 unfolds, we see even more inventive uses of this remarkable material.

Top Body Armor Innovations of 2025
1. Adaptive Armor Systems
Leading the pack is the emergence of adaptive armor systems. These innovative designs allow the user to modify the level of protection according to the situation. For example, a lightweight vest can be worn during routine patrols, while additional panels can be attached for high-risk missions. This flexibility ensures that individuals can remain agile without sacrificing safety.
The latest adaptive armor options utilize layers of para-aramid, effectively enabling the user to customize the thickness and coverage area of their gear, fostering an environment where personal safety can be aligned with mission requirements.
2. Ultralight Plates
Another game-changer in 2025 is the creation of ultralight balistic plates that incorporate para-aramid fibers. These plates provide comparable protection levels to heavier alternatives but weigh significantly less. The reduction in weight translates into improved mobility and comfort, critical factors for anyone needing to wear armor for prolonged periods.
Ultralight plates are designed to withstand various threats, including firearms and sharp projectiles. This dual focus on safety and ease-of-use represents a significant advancement in body armor technology.
